Up for sale is another of these beautiful, bright Hemingray blue CD 145s. Although I'm a fanatic for Canadian glass, I have to admit that I love the way these Hemingray blue pieces sparkle in the sunlight. This piece is amazingly clean, with absolutely no sign of staining, soot, anything along those lines. This piece is the [100] embossing style, with HEMINGRAY / MADE IN U.S.A. on the front, and "No. 21" on the rear. The really neat part about this one is the ghost-embossing of HEMINGRAY just above the embossing on the front skirt. All of "MINGRAY" is visible above the HEMINGRAY embossing. The ghosting is not particularly clear, but on a quick glance you can easily see the "washboard" look of the glass above the embossing, and a closer look quite easily reveals the shapes of each of the letters. Unusually enough, the letters in "MADE" are also very widely spaced. I am not sure why this is, but the spacing of the letters in "MADE" is easily twice that of the letters in "HEMINGRAY". A bit of an odd piece! These are normally badly chipped up in the drips department. This one isn't too bad in that area, with a total of 8 partially nicked drips. Only 2 of these are visible from the front view shown, however. Aside from those nicked drips, there is one very, very flat inner skirt flake about 1/8" wide.
